IN MEXICO.

THE TROUBLE WITH AMERICA

INVASION NOT INTENDED,

New York, June 18.

A Ileuter message from Washington states that the call to the Militia does not contemplate an invasion, of Mexico, but is for protection of the border against bandits. The men will be sent to the border as required.
